Gabapentinoids for Pruritus in Older Adults: Dermatological Applications

Gabapentin and pregabalin show effectiveness in treating chronic pruritus of neuropathic origin, gaining popularity in dermatological practice for managing cutaneous symptoms in older adults, underscoring their therapeutic potential beyond traditional antiepileptic indications.

Microbial Keratitis: Addressing the Growing Concerns in Contact Lens Wearers

Increasing use of contact lenses in children raises concerns about microbial keratitis, emphasizing the importance of preventive measures and vigilant eye care practices to minimize the risk of sight-threatening corneal infections.

FDA and CDC Pause Use of Johnson & Johnson Vaccine: Safety Concerns

Following reports of rare blood clotting events, the FDA and CDC recommend a pause in the use of the Johnson & Johnson vaccine, highlighting the importance of post-authorization safety monitoring and rapid response to vaccine-related adverse events.

Pregnancy and Kidney Stone Risk: Postpartum Persistence

Pregnancy increases the risk of kidney stones, with elevated risk persisting up to a year after giving birth, highlighting the need for targeted preventive interventions and postpartum monitoring in at-risk populations.

Triple vs. Double Inhalation Therapy in Moderate to Severe Asthma: Comparative Efficacy and Safety

Triple therapy is associated with fewer severe exacerbations compared to double inhalation therapy in patients with moderate to severe asthma, supporting the use of combination therapy for optimized asthma control and reduced disease burden.
